Meet our beauty, Xenovia. Very weird long story on how she arrived, but in short she was deemed a stray. We found out she had a large tumor on her front leg that was removed. Her vet had suggested leg amputation, supposedly. Our vet found no proof of cancer and chose not to remove her leg.
Novia is doing great. She is approx. 9 years of age. Weighs approx. 45lbs. She has a very interesting coat. Light brown and white with dark brown spotting. She is a wonderful girl. Walks well on leash. Has a few manners and loves to be with her people friends. She is not reactive to other dogs and we feel she would do well with most. We would need to cat test her but feel she would do OK with cats also. She is just an all round sweet lady!
